The Graphic Designer and Production Specialist has a dual role working in a dynamic, creative, and fast-paced environment to design, manufacture, and assemble sign and graphic products that meet customer requirements.
In the computer room, this position is responsible for creating computer generated vinyl and/or full color graphics output that can be printed, weeded, and mounted to a substrate. This process may involve various levels of artistic creativity that ultimately leads to a completed design created from customer drawings, logos, and other art files.
In the production room, this position is responsible for all aspects of the physical construction and assembling of signs from the cut and wide format printed vinyl output. Sign assembly includes preparing substrates and applying the vinyl or other media according to written instructions and approved proofs. Also, setting up and operating the laminator for over-laminating and mounting of these digital imaged products is required. Proofreading signs and conducting quality assurance to ensure the accuracy of signs is critically important.RESPONSIBILITIES
Prepare comprehensive designs of illustrations, sketches, layouts, and copy for print reproduction according to instructions of client or sales team
Provide proofs and renderings for customer approval that layout the sign design and specify sign sizing, graphics and text
Print graphics and text on wide format printer and/or cut graphics and text using a vinyl plotter
Weed excess vinyl from computer generated prints and/or cut images using exacto blades or similar
Prepare substrates for application. This may include cutting, painting, laminating, or cleaning the substrate using hand tools and light power tools
Perform finishing operations such as laminating and/or mounting of vinyl graphics on substrate
Manufacture and assemble signs using basic power tools to include adding decorative and/or installation hardware to substrates
Perform quality assurance measures pre- and post-construction by accurately reading and interpreting a Work Order and then proofing for errors or unacceptable standards
Maintain all equipment including computers, plotters, laminators and printers in good working order
Maintain design and production rates that meet or exceed established standards and customer requirements
Identify and implement efficiency improvements that minimize waste, reduce costs, and shorten lead times
Install signs and graphics in the field (vehicles, windows, exterior and interior walls) as needed
Perform other duties as needed such as answering the phone, helping at the front counter, consulting with customers, housekeeping, etc.
